Primetime Ratings Report for the week of March 4, 2013 (Based on National Live + Same Day Program Ratings)

ABC Delivers 5 of the Top 20 Regular Broadcast Shows in Adults 18-49

Week No. 24

During the week of March 4, 2013, ABC delivered 5 of the Top 20 regular broadcast shows in Adults 18-49: "The Bachelor" - No. 6, "Once Upon a Time" - No. 14, "Modern Family-R" - No. 19, while "Shark Tank" (2-month high) and "Revenge" (2-month high) tied at No. 20. Hitting a 3-month high on Friday, ABC's "20/20" qualified as the week's No. 1 newsmagazine in Adults 18-49 (tied w/"60 Minutes"). ABC outperformed NBC by substantial margins in Total Viewers (+54% - 5.4 million vs. 3.5 million) and Adults 18-49 (+36% - 1.5/4 vs. 1.1/3), leading for the 6th straight week and 7th time in 8 weeks.

Monday

With "The Bachelor: The Women Tell All" and a repeat "Castle," ABC finished a strong second on Monday in Adults 18-49 to Fox's originals (from 8:00 - 10:00 p.m., ABC beat Fox's prime). Both "The Bachelor" and "Castle" finished No. 1 in their respective time periods in Adults 18-49. The Net was

up over the same night last year (3/5/12) in viewers (+4% - 8.0 million vs. 7.7 million) and young adults (+10% - 2.3/6 vs. 2.1/6).

"The Bachelor: The Women Tell All" (8:00-10:01 p.m.)

Leading up to next week's season finale, "The Bachelor: The Women Tell All" won its 2-hour time period among Adults 18-49 (2.8/7), outdelivering Fox's original drama lineup by 12% (2.5/7 - "Bones"/"The Following"). Head to head, the ABC unscripted series continued to pace well ahead of NBC's "The Biggest Loser 14" in Total Viewers (+42% - 8.5 million vs. 6.0 million) and Adults 18-49 (+27% - 2.8/7 vs. 2.2/6). Once again posting year-to-year gains, "The Bachelor" was up over the year-ago "Women Tell All" (8.2 million and 2.5/6 on 3/5/12) in Total Viewers (+4%) and Adults 18-49 (+8%).

· Season to date, "The Bachelor" is up over the same point last year in both viewers (+3%) and young adults (+3%).

"Castle" (10:01-11:00 p.m.)

Although airing an encore, ABC's "Castle" won the 10 o'clock hour for the 3rd straight week with Total Viewers and Adults 18-49 versus its CBS and NBC competition. The repeat ABC drama doubled the audience (+100% - 6.8 million vs. 3.4 million) of NBC's original "Deception" and led by 27% in Adults 18-49 (1.4/4 vs. 1.1/3). "Castle" generated its biggest repeat numbers in close to 2 years with Total Viewers and Adults 18-49 (tie) - since 4/25/11.

Tuesday

"Celebrity Wife Swap" (8:00-9:00 p.m.)

During the 8 o'clock hour against the first hour of a special "American Idol" and CBS' top-rated "NCIS," ABC's "Celebrity Wife Swap" beat out its NBC competition by 50% in Adults 18-49 (1.5/4 vs. 1.0/3). Opposite "Idol" and "NCIS," the ABC unscripted series built by 21% in Adults 18-49 (1.4/4 to 1.7/5) from its first half-hour to second half-hour. On average, "Celebrity Wife Swap" is improving the hour for ABC year to year by 25% in Adults 18-49 (2.0/6 vs. 1.6/5).

"The Taste" (9:00-10:00 p.m.)

In its new 9 o'clock time slot, ABC's "The Taste" beat NBC's comedies in the hour ("Go On"/"The New Normal") for the 2nd week in a row in both Total Viewers (+14% - 3.2 million vs. 2.8 million) and Adults 18-49 (+20% - 1.2/3 vs. 1.0/3). The new ABC unscripted series delivered strong retention of its week-ago time period premiere in Adults 18-49 (86%) and Adults 18-34 (90%)

"Body of Proof" (10:00-11:00 p.m.)

At 10:00 p.m., ABC's "Body of Proof" held its largest advantages yet over "Smash," once again more than doubling the overall audience of the NBC drama (+144% - 6.6 million vs. 2.7 million) and leading by 63% in Adults 18-49 (1.3/4 vs. 0.8/2). "Body of Proof" was up week to week in Total Viewers (+3% - 6.6 million vs. 6.4 million) and Adults 18-49 (+8% - 1.3/4 vs. 1.2/3), hitting a new season high in the young adult demo.

Wednesday

"The Middle" (8:00-8:30 p.m.)

At 8:00 p.m., ABC's repeat "The Middle" beat out NBC's original "Whitney" by 2.1 million viewers (5.9 million vs. 3.8 million) and by 23% in Adults 18-49 (1.6/5 vs. 1.3/4). In addition, the encore ABC comedy outdelivered CBS' "Survivor" in the half-hour in Adults 18-34 (+20%) and Men 18-34 (+38%). In viewers and young adults, "The Middle" marked its 2nd-highest repeat numbers since December 2011 - since 12/14/11.

"The Neighbors" (8:30-9:00 p.m.)

Building on its lead-in (+6%), ABC's "The Neighbors" retained 100% of its Adult 18-49 delivery (1.7/5) week to week despite coming out of an encore "The Middle." Like its lead-in, "The Neighbors" beat out CBS' "Survivor" in the slot with Men 18-34 (+11%).

"Modern Family" (9:00-9:31 p.m.)

Building on its lead-in at 9:00 p.m., ABC's repeat "Modern Family" finished as Wednesday's No. 1 scripted TV show in Adults 18-49 (2.1/5) on the major nets.

"Suburgatory" (9:31-10:00 p.m.)

During the 9:30 p.m. half-hour against the conclusion of "Idol," ABC's "Suburgatory" was the No. 1 scripted show with Women 18-49 (2.2/5) and Teens 12-17 (1.2/4) on the major nets.

"Nashville" (10:00-11:00 p.m.)

During the 10 o'clock hour, ABC's "Nashville" was up over its last repeat in Total Viewers (+7% - 3.2 million vs. 3.0 million) and matched the series' best encore Adult 18-49 number (0.9/3).

Friday

Growing week to week in Adults 18-49 against all-original competition, ABC posted its top-rated Friday since November 9, 2012. On the night, ABC (1.7/5) outdelivered CBS by 31% (1.3/4), NBC by 70% (1.0/3) and Fox by 70% (1.0/3). "Shark Tank" was Friday's No. 1 TV show with key adults on the major networks and "20/20" was Friday's top-rated newsmagazine in Total Viewers, Adults 18-49 (4th week in a row) and Adults 25-54 (4th week in a row).

"Last Man Standing"/"Malibu Country" (8:00-9:00 p.m.)

From 8:00-9:00 p.m. among Adults 18-49, ABC's "Last Man Standing" and "Malibu Country" (1.4/5) tied CBS' "Undercover Boss" (1.4/5), while beating Fox's "Kitchen Nightmares" by 17% (1.2/4) and NBC's season premiere of "Fashion Star" by 75% (0.8/3). Despite the new competition, the ABC comedies paced within 1-tenth of a rating point in the 8 o'clock hour week to week.

"Shark Tank" (9:00-10:01 p.m.)

At 9:00 p.m., ABC's "Shark Tank" built on its Adult 18-49 lead-in (+54%) to earn its highest rating since January 11, 2013, equaling its best performance since November (since 11/9/12). In the hour, the ABC unscripted series (2.0/6) beat NBC's return of "Grimm" by 33% (1.5/5), CBS' "Golden Boy" by 100% (1.0/3) and Fox's "Touch" by 186% (0.7/2). Season to date, "Shark Tank" is up 17% in Adults 18-49, producing its best season ever.

"20/20" (10:01-11:00 p.m.)

ABC's "20/20" won the 10 o'clock hour in Adults 18-49 (1.6/5) over its net rivals, beating CBS' "Blue Bloods" by 14% (1.4/5) and NBC's "Rock Center with Brian Williams" by 78% (0.9/3). From 10:00-11:00 p.m., "20/20" also outperformed its NBC newsmagazine competition by 45% in Total Viewers (5.5 million vs. 3.8 million) and by 62% in Adults 25-54 (2.1/6 vs. 1.3/3). "20/20" reported on housing nightmares, unusual homes, awful neighbors and real estate's dirty secrets. Growing week to week in Adults 18-49 (+14%) and Adults 25-54 (+5%), the ABC newsmagazine earned its top ratings since December 14, 2012.

Sunday

Please Note: On the first Sunday of Daylight Saving Time, overall TV usage declined notably during the opening hours of the night. Adult 18-49 PUTs were off -6% during the 7 o'clock hour (30.8 vs. 32.7) and down -7% in the 8 o'clock hour (35.7 vs. 38.2).

"Once Upon a Time" (8:00-9:00 p.m.)

Spiking over its Adult 18-49 lead-in (+64%) at 8:00 p.m., ABC's "Once Upon a Time" ran neck-and-neck with CBS' "Amazing Race" for the lead in the hour, closing the gap week to week and pacing within 1-tenth of a rating point (2.3/6 vs. 2.4/7). The ABC drama once again won its time slot with key Women (W18-34/W18-49) to stand as Sunday's top-rated broadcast series.

· Despite facing declining viewing levels week to week, "Once Upon a Time" was up in Total Viewers (+3%), Adults 18-49 (+5%), Adults 18-34 (+6%) and Kids 2-11 (+22%), drawing its biggest overall audience in nearly 2 months - since 1/20/13.

"Revenge" (9:00-10:01 p.m.)

Up 11% in Adults 18-49 from its last telecast 3 weeks ago before "The Oscars," ABC's "Revenge" (2.0/5) returned with strong lead-in retention (87%), beating the first hour of NBC's "Celebrity Apprentice" by 18% (1.7/4) and CBS' "The Good Wife" by 33% (1.5/4) during the 9 o'clock hour. In addition, the sophomore drama made ABC the No. 1 broadcaster in the hour with Adults 25-54 and across all key Women demos.

· Building for its 2nd airing in Total Viewers (+17%) and Adults 18-49 (+11%), "Revenge" posted its best numbers since the beginning of January - since 1/6/13. Season to date, "Revenge" has gained 21% in Adults 18-49 over the same point in its freshman season.

"Red Widow" (10:01-11:00 p.m.)

During the 10 o'clock hour, ABC's "Red Widow" retained 80% of its week ago 2-hour series debut in Adults 18-34 (0.8/2 vs. 1.0/3). Based on the first 3 days of TV playback (Live + 3 Day Ratings), "Red Widow" (on 3/3/13 from 9:00-11:00 p.m.) grew over its Live +Same Day numbers by 1.8 million viewers (7.1 million to 8.9 million) and by 27% in Adults 18-49 (1.5 rating to a 1.9 rating).

Source: The Nielsen Company (National, Live+ Same Day Program Ratings), week of 03/04/13.
